Super Bowl Sunday is coming up, and the Texas Department of Transportation urges fans to plan a sober ride for game-day.

As fans travel to watch parties or other activities to for the Super Bowl that involve alcohol, it is important that they find safe ways to get to and from.

During the 2018 Super Bowl weekend, there were 258 alcohol-related crashes in Texas alone. Eight people were killed and 21 were seriously injured.
